First Machinima movie on the IMDB

Posted by Peter Rasmussen on July 23, 2007

IMDB

Stolen Life is the first machinima movie to make it onto the Internet Movie database. In these days of DV video and YouTube it has become much harder to get a movie listed on IMDB. I think it’s a good sign for machinima.

Interactive Story Telling

Posted by Peter Rasmussen on July 8, 2007

I was fascinated to read a post by “3dfilmmaker” at 3dFilmMaker.com
http://www.3dfilmmaker.com/
He talks about the exciting new possibilities of “Interactive story telling” via the medium of Machinima. As 3DFM says the concept of interactive story itself is not new. You only have to visit
The Just Adventure web site
http://www.justadventure.com/
To see how dedicated the adventure game audience is.

I’m very excited to here interactive story telling is on it’s way back. At the outset I was not as big a fan of shooters as I was of story games. One of the most outstanding examples of “Interactive Movies” is the Tex Murphy series of games starring Chris Jones. He coined the phrase. Chris was also Co-author of the series. The Tex Murphy series was a leader in the field. It combined the ability to investigate the scene in three-dimensional space with the latest at that time in multimedia interaction and great science fiction detective stories. 

Chris Jones stars in the feature length machinima movie Stolen Life just released on DVD

Podcast Special on Machinima Feature Film

Posted by Peter Rasmussen on July 3, 2007

The Scapecast Podcast has offered to do a show on stolen Life.

Scapecast is a podcast dedicated to the legendary sci-fi Farscape series starring Claudia Black and Ben Browder. They do discussions and analysis on episodes and follow cast and crew’s careers on through other projects.

Scapecast did an interview with the director of “Stolen Life” Jackie Turnure last year at DragonCon. The feedback was so good they are devoting episode 34 to Stolen Life and Claudia’s character, Aeryn Sun. The tentative release date for that ep is 7/20.

The Stolen Life DVD will be offered as a prize. There will be a puzzle to solve. The question is “How many characters are there on the cover of the DVD”. It’s not straightforward. There is a clue in the trailer. The cover is the same as the poster. You can find the trailer and a large version of the poster on the stolen life web site.
